In this report, we show that both glucose and glutamine are essential during OC differentiation, and both contribute to the maintenance of the TCA cycle. Early differentiation is associated with a broken TCA cycle, with IRG1 siphoning TCA intermediates for the production of itaconate, which accumulates extracellularly, stimulating the function of osteoblasts in vitro an in vivo and in vivo and is necessary to retain bone mass in mice. Comparative gene expression profiling analysis of RNA-seq data for bone marrow derived cells treated with MCSF or MCSF+RANKL with or without glutamine or glucose
